Before you start driving your car rental in Victoria BC, you need to know the traffic rules. You should drive on the right side on the road, like you do in other North American countries. Free right turns at the red signal are only allowed when a sign gives you permission. Be sure to wear your seat belts as this is legally required. Speed and distance are measured by the metric system. Miles are calculated in kilometers, which are 5/9 of a single mile. The speed limit signs are shown in km/hr. The rental cars available in Victoria BC have both odometers and speedometers, which are standardized in kilometers. Occasionally, you can find a vehicle that has speedometers with both miles and kilometers.
Generally, 18 kilometers denotes 10 miles. You can notice the speed limit mentioning 50km/hr, which implies 30 miles/hr. Normally, 50km/hr is the typical speed limit in the towns and cities. In the major thoroughfares, you will see the speed limit go up to 80km/ hr, implying 50mph. And on the highways, it is 100km/hr, which is 60mph.
